From 2c86d9189d6f3b09f7526437eacdce35c213874f Mon Sep 17 00:00:00 2001 From: Brendan Chen Date: Sun, 2 Feb 2025 14:57:06 -0800 Subject: [PATCH] update refreshed time on token generation --- src/services/NotificationService.ts |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/services/NotificationService.ts b/src/services/NotificationService.ts index 1eca53c..33533ba 100644 --- a/src/services/NotificationService.ts +++ b/src/services/NotificationService.ts @@ -38,15 +38,17 @@ export class NotificationService { "kid": keyId, }; + const now = Date.now(); const claimsPayload = { "iss": teamId, - "iat": Date.now(), + "iat": now, }; this.token = jwt.sign(claimsPayload, privateKey, { algorithm: "ES256", header: tokenHeader }); + this._lastRefreshedTimeMs = now; } private lastReloadedTimeForAPNsIsTooRecent() {